Definition:

A shortened version of the term Implementation Force, IFOR was a NATO led military group sent into Bosnia-Hercegovina and Croatia at the end of 1995 to help enforce the Dayton Accords, which bought peace to the war torn region. IFOR’s mandate was for a year, and a smaller NATO force called SFOR / Stabilization Force replaced it at the end of 1996.
